The Story

Supersweet, bi-colour variety for main season production. Sturdy plants with attractive ears of corn and cobs well protected with good husk cover. Cobs typically 18-20cm in length with excellent tip fill. Juicy, sweet kernels and tender bite. Good resistance to common rust.

Supersweet corn are varieties of sweet corn which produce higher than normal levels of sugar (4 to 10 times more sugar than normal su sweet corn). They have been developed by natural breeding methods and have a shrivelled โ€œshrunkenโ€ kernel and low levels of starch hence they prefer warmer conditions for successful germination (20 -30 degrees soil temperature) than standard sweet corn varieties.

Sowing can begin early October for warmer parts of the country through until mid-November for cooler regions. Sweet corn will take around 90 โ€“ 100 days to mature from sowing. Ensure you have sufficient soil warmth to ensure a good germination rate but sufficient time for cobs to mature before it begins to cool in early Autumn.
